summaryrefslogtreecommitdiff
path: root/network/xinetd/xinetd-add_destdir.patch
diff options
context:
space:
mode:
authorChris Abela <kristofru@gmail.com>2012-11-25 20:41:40 -0600
committerdsomero <xgizzmo@slackbuilds.org>2012-12-11 16:20:48 -0500
commitdfb782844d895d93cc8abb8bb326d85487b01e16 (patch)
treedf649250683435fd4768a04b8270b763ab2eb8e2 /network/xinetd/xinetd-add_destdir.patch
parent4ed01224d9fc8d361d37e0ecd91a1f4df9f909b9 (diff)
downloadslackbuilds-dfb782844d895d93cc8abb8bb326d85487b01e16.tar.gz
network/xinetd: Updated for version 2.3.15.
Also create /var/lock/subsys/ in rc.xinetd instead of putting it inside the package; this handles the case where a sysadmin puts /var/lock as tmpfs (e.g. /var/lock -> /run/lock) Signed-off-by: Robby Workman <rworkman@slackbuilds.org>
Diffstat (limited to 'network/xinetd/xinetd-add_destdir.patch')
-rw-r--r--network/xinetd/xinetd-add_destdir.patch48
1 files changed, 48 insertions, 0 deletions
diff --git a/network/xinetd/xinetd-add_destdir.patch b/network/xinetd/xinetd-add_destdir.patch
new file mode 100644
index 0000000000..6504ef07d6
--- /dev/null
+++ b/network/xinetd/xinetd-add_destdir.patch
@@ -0,0 +1,48 @@
+diff -Nur xinetd-2.3.14.orig//Makefile.in xinetd-2.3.14/Makefile.in
+--- xinetd-2.3.14.orig//Makefile.in 2003-08-15 09:00:45.000000000 -0500
++++ xinetd-2.3.14/Makefile.in 2010-11-24 23:45:57.615587280 -0600
+@@ -75,27 +75,27 @@
+
+ install: build
+ for i in $(DAEMONDIR) $(BINDIR) $(MANDIR)/man5 $(MANDIR)/man8 ; do \
+- test -d $$i || mkdir -p $$i ; done
+- $(INSTALL_CMD) -m 755 xinetd/xinetd $(DAEMONDIR)
+- $(INSTALL_CMD) -m 755 xinetd/itox $(DAEMONDIR)
+- $(INSTALL_CMD) -m 755 $(SRCDIR)/xinetd/xconv.pl $(DAEMONDIR)
+- $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.conf.man $(MANDIR)/man5/xinetd.conf.5
+- $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.log.man $(MANDIR)/man8/xinetd.log.8
+- $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.man $(MANDIR)/man8/xinetd.8
+- $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/itox.8 $(MANDIR)/man8/itox.8
+- $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xconv.pl.8 $(MANDIR)/man8/xconv.pl.8
++ test -d $(DESTDIR)/$$i || mkdir -p $(DESTDIR)/$$i ; done
++ $(INSTALL_CMD) -m 755 xinetd/xinetd $(DESTDIR)/$(DAEMONDIR)
++ $(INSTALL_CMD) -m 755 xinetd/itox $(DESTDIR)/$(DAEMONDIR)
++ $(INSTALL_CMD) -m 755 $(SRCDIR)/xinetd/xconv.pl $(DESTDIR)/$(DAEMONDIR)
++ $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.conf.man $(DESTDIR)/$(MANDIR)/man5/xinetd.conf.5
++ $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.log.man $(DESTDIR)/$(MANDIR)/man8/xinetd.log.8
++ $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xinetd.man $(DESTDIR)/$(MANDIR)/man8/xinetd.8
++ $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/itox.8 $(DESTDIR)/$(MANDIR)/man8/itox.8
++ $(INSTALL_CMD) -m 644 $(SRCDIR)/xinetd/xconv.pl.8 $(DESTDIR)/$(MANDIR)/man8/xconv.pl.8
+ @echo "You must put your xinetd.conf in /etc/xinetd.conf"
+ @echo "There is a sample config file in xinetd/sample.conf and you can"
+ @echo "use xconv.pl to convert your old inetd.conf file to an xinetd format"
+
+ uninstall:
+- rm -f $(DAEMONDIR)/xinetd
+- rm -f $(DAEMONDIR)/itox
+- rm -f $(DAEMONDIR)/xconv.pl
+- rm -f $(MANDIR)/man5/xinetd.conf.5
+- rm -f $(MANDIR)/man8/xinetd.log.8
+- rm -f $(MANDIR)/man8/xinetd.8
+- rm -f $(MANDIR)/man8/itox.8
++ rm -f $(DESTDIR)/$(DAEMONDIR)/xinetd
++ rm -f $(DESTDIR)/$(DAEMONDIR)/itox
++ rm -f $(DESTDIR)/$(DAEMONDIR)/xconv.pl
++ rm -f $(DESTDIR)/$(MANDIR)/man5/xinetd.conf.5
++ rm -f $(DESTDIR)/$(MANDIR)/man8/xinetd.log.8
++ rm -f $(DESTDIR)/$(MANDIR)/man8/xinetd.8
++ rm -f $(DESTDIR)/$(MANDIR)/man8/itox.8
+
+ distclean: clean
+ rm -f config.cache config.log Makefile config.status xinetd/itox
+